Itinerary Details
Day 1
(MD, Motel) Travel via the Darling Scarp to Toodyay for morning tea break then onto Goomalling, Wyalkatchem for lunch with an optional visit to the Agricultural Museum. East to Mukinbudin and into the Shire of Yilgarn at Bullfinch before reaching our base at Southern Cross.
Day 2
(FB, MD, Motel) We spend the day exploring the interesting features of the region, granite outcrops, dams, soaks and lookouts. During the day we hope to find Orchids, Verticordia, Cassia, Grevillea, Damperia and others. Returning to Southern Cross to visit the Yilgarn Museum and dive into the second gold strike in WA after Halls Creek. Note: Museum entry included.
Day 3
(FB, MD, Motel) South of Southern Cross in the Shire of Kondinin we take a walk in the scrub to look for Sundews, Hakea, Leptospermum, Chamelaucium, Synaphea and Acacia. After lunch head over to Wave Rock and Hippos Yawn on the northern face of Hyden Rock. Into Mulkas Cave to view the rock art from the colossal Mulka before returning to Southern Cross. Note: All entries included.
Day 4
(FB) Following the Goldfields Water Supply Pipeline back towards Perth to Merredin and Kellerberrin then south through the fertile soils of the Wheatbelt we come to Quairading. Reaching the Avon Valley and the beautifully restored town of York to visit the York Motor Museum in the middle of town. Back through the blue Lechenaultia down the Darling Scarp into Perth.
